What occurs during a chemical reaction?

The change in the chemical properties of a substance.

2
New cards

What observations help determine if a chemical reaction has taken place?

Change in state, change in color, evolution of a gas, change in temperature.

3
New cards

What is the skeletal chemical equation for the burning of magnesium in air?

Mg + O2 → MgO

4
New cards

What is the law of conservation of mass?

Mass can neither be created nor destroyed in a chemical reaction.

5
New cards

What is the balanced chemical equation for the reaction of iron with steam?

3Fe(s) + 4H2O(g) → Fe3O4(s) + 4H2(g)

6
New cards

What is a combination reaction?

A reaction in which a single product is formed from two or more reactants.

7
New cards

What is the chemical equation for the reaction of quick lime with water?

CaO(s) + H2O(l) → Ca(OH)2(aq) + Heat

8
New cards

What are exothermic chemical reactions?

Reactions in which heat is released along with the formation of products.

9
New cards

Give an example of an exothermic reaction.

Decomposition of vegetable matter into compost.

10
New cards

What is a decomposition reaction?

A single reactant breaks down to give simpler products.

11
New cards

What is the decomposition of ferrous sulphate when heated?

2FeSO4(s) → Fe2O3(s) + SO2(g) + SO3(g)

12
New cards

What is thermal decomposition?

Decomposition reaction carried out by heating.

13
New cards

What is the thermal decomposition reaction of lead nitrate?

2Pb(NO3)2(s) → 2PbO(s) + 4NO2(g) + O2(g)

14
New cards

What are endothermic reactions?

Reactions in which energy is absorbed.

15
New cards

What is the displacement reaction between iron and copper sulphate?

Fe(s) + CuSO4(aq) → FeSO4(aq) + Cu(s)

16
New cards

What are double displacement reactions?

Reactions in which there is an exchange of ions between the reactants.

17
New cards

What is a double displacement reaction between sodium sulphate and barium chloride?

Na2SO4(aq) + BaCl2(aq) → BaSO4(s) + 2NaCl(aq)

18
New cards

What is a precipitate?

An insoluble substance formed during a reaction.

19
New cards

What is a precipitation reaction?

A reaction that produces a precipitate.

20
New cards

What is oxidation?

Gain of oxygen.

21
New cards

What is reduction?

Loss of oxygen.

22
New cards

Give an example of a reaction where copper oxide is reduced by hydrogen.

CuO + H2 → Cu + H2O

23
New cards

What are redox reactions?

Reactions where one reactant gets oxidized while the other gets reduced.

24
New cards

What is corrosion?

When a metal is attacked by substances around it leading to damage.

25
New cards

What is rancidity?

When fats and oils are oxidized, leading to a change in smell and taste.

26
New cards

What are antioxidants?

Substances that prevent oxidation.
